Cablevision started buying up shares in 1994. Buying up MSG's controlling interest then the other half three yrs later. At the time, Jimmy Dolan wasn't in charge but Charles Dolan, founder of the company did.

As for Glen Sather, once he stopped giving aging scoffers bad contracts like Lindros, Bure, etc and started drafting and adding more grinding 2 way players, things started to click.

Sather deserves a lot of credit. Even when he was terrible he never lost a trade and a lot of the young pieces that we have are products of him finally realizing the need to build your core through the draft in the NHL and also absolutely bending teams over in trades. Couple that with some shrewd moves in free agency and finally understanding the importance of holding onto your assets and maintaing cap flexibility and this is the result. I think AV deserves a ton of credit too. The team took a while to gel but he always remained patient with the players and gave them all the confidence that they could contribute whereas of course Torts tended to alienate guys and point the finger elsewhere.
